> That's why the TigerVNC build system allows you to specify where the
> libjpeg-turbo headers and libs can be found. The default is not to look
> for them in /usr, because even though some prominent Linux distros are
> shipping libjpeg-turbo now, many of them still don't, and thus the
> assumption is that people will either build libjpeg-turbo from source
> (which installs it by default in /opt/libjpeg-turbo) or they will use
> the official libjpeg-turbo SDK packages (which also installs it in
> /opt/libjpeg-turbo.) BUILDING.txt in the TigerVNC source says all of
> that quite plainly.
